Hey, if you're on call for the Briskcart checkout flow, the load test rig lives on the perf cluster in our Veldstad datacenter. Kick it off with the standard ramp profile, watch p95 latency on the payment-intent step, and don't panic if the first minute looks ugly — warmup is slow. If anything crosses the red line, page the platform channel and quote the build token printed below.

pipeline stamp: htk9_ce63042d9

## Relevance Tuning: Limits and Quotas

Welcome to the Quillbrook search team. Relevance tuning on the Lanternfield index is governed by hard quotas: boost factors are clamped server-side, and synonym expansions are capped per query to protect latency budgets. Never raise a limit without running the offline judgment suite first, and note that changes take up to two hours to propagate through the shard fleet. Before editing anything, read this whole page twice. The current tuning constants are listed below:

tuning table, bagep-tahof:
RATE_LIMITS = {
    "ralael": 10,
    "druath": 5,
}

// Per-message deflate on the Quillgate socket tier is intentionally
// disabled above this frame size. Compression saved ~30% bandwidth in
// testing but tripled CPU on the relay pods during the Harrowfield
// load event, and memory ballooned from per-connection contexts.
// If you flip this, watch relay CPU closely. The build where this
// threshold was last tuned is recorded directly below.

trace token, fafog-kageg: htk4_98e6